Пример5: Вычисление стоимости звонков: различия между версиями
Перейти к навигации
Перейти к поиску
Vovan (обсуждение | вклад) |
Vovan (обсуждение | вклад) |
||
Строка 1: | Строка 1: | ||
− | // test.cpp : Defines the entry point for the console application. | + | // test.cpp : Defines the entry point for the console application. |
− | // | + | // |
− | #include "stdafx.h" | + | #include "stdafx.h" |
− | #include "math.h" | + | #include "math.h" |
− | #include <iostream> | + | #include <iostream> |
− | using namespace std; | + | using namespace std; |
− | int _tmain(int argc, _TCHAR* argv[]) | + | int _tmain(int argc, _TCHAR* argv[]) |
− | { int kod=0; float k_min=0, sum=0; | + | { int kod=0; float k_min=0, sum=0; |
− | setlocale(LC_ALL,"Rus"); | + | setlocale(LC_ALL,"Rus"); |
− | printf("Программа вычисления длительностей разгороров:\n\n Введите код желаемого города:"); | + | printf("Программа вычисления длительностей разгороров:\n\n Введите код желаемого города:"); |
− | scanf ("%d", &kod); | + | scanf ("%d", &kod); |
− | printf("\nВведите количество минут разговора:"); | + | printf("\nВведите количество минут разговора:"); |
− | scanf ("%f", &k_min); | + | scanf ("%f", &k_min); |
− | switch (kod){ | + | switch (kod){ |
− | case 423: sum=k_min*2.2; printf ("\n Город: Владивосток,\nЕго код:423,\nразговор продолжался:%f минут,\nсумма по минутам:%2.3f\n рублей",k_min, sum); break; | + | case 423: sum=k_min*2.2; printf ("\n Город: Владивосток,\nЕго код:423,\nразговор продолжался:%f минут,\nсумма по минутам:%2.3f\n рублей",k_min, sum); |
− | case 95: sum=k_min*2.2; printf ("\n Город: Москва,\nЕго код:095,\nразговор продолжался:%f минут,\nсумма по минутам:%2.3f\n рублей", k_min, sum); break; | + | break; |
− | case 815: sum=k_min*2.2; printf ("\n Город: Мурманск,\nЕго код:815,\nразговор продолжался:%f минут,\nсумма по минутам:%2.3f\n рублей", k_min,sum); break; case 846: sum=k_min*2.2; printf ("\n Город: Самара,\nЕго код:846,\nразговор продолжался:%f минут,\nсумма по минутам:%2.3f\n рублей", k_min, sum); break;default : printf("Извините, города с таким кодом нет :-(\n"); | + | case 95: sum=k_min*2.2; printf ("\n Город: Москва,\nЕго код:095,\nразговор продолжался:%f минут,\nсумма по минутам:%2.3f\n рублей", k_min, sum); break; |
+ | case 815: sum=k_min*2.2; printf ("\n Город: Мурманск,\nЕго код:815,\nразговор продолжался:%f минут,\nсумма по минутам:%2.3f\n рублей", k_min,sum); | ||
+ | break; case 846: sum=k_min*2.2; printf ("\n Город: Самара,\nЕго код:846,\nразговор продолжался:%f минут,\nсумма по минутам:%2.3f\n рублей", k_min, sum); | ||
+ | break; | ||
+ | default : printf("Извините, города с таким кодом нет :-(\n"); | ||
} | } | ||
system("pause"); | system("pause"); | ||
return 0; | return 0; | ||
} | } |
Текущая версия на 13:58, 12 ноября 2008
// test.cpp : Defines the entry point for the console application. // #include "stdafx.h" #include "math.h" #include <iostream> using namespace std; int _tmain(int argc, _TCHAR* argv[]) { int kod=0; float k_min=0, sum=0; setlocale(LC_ALL,"Rus"); printf("Программа вычисления длительностей разгороров:\n\n Введите код желаемого города:"); scanf ("%d", &kod); printf("\nВведите количество минут разговора:"); scanf ("%f", &k_min); switch (kod){ case 423: sum=k_min*2.2; printf ("\n Город: Владивосток,\nЕго код:423,\nразговор продолжался:%f минут,\nсумма по минутам:%2.3f\n рублей",k_min, sum); break; case 95: sum=k_min*2.2; printf ("\n Город: Москва,\nЕго код:095,\nразговор продолжался:%f минут,\nсумма по минутам:%2.3f\n рублей", k_min, sum); break; case 815: sum=k_min*2.2; printf ("\n Город: Мурманск,\nЕго код:815,\nразговор продолжался:%f минут,\nсумма по минутам:%2.3f\n рублей", k_min,sum); break; case 846: sum=k_min*2.2; printf ("\n Город: Самара,\nЕго код:846,\nразговор продолжался:%f минут,\nсумма по минутам:%2.3f\n рублей", k_min, sum); break; default : printf("Извините, города с таким кодом нет :-(\n"); } system("pause"); return 0; }